> I need your help for this matter. I get stuck when trying to add new
> extension to x509 cert. In Windows 2000 Server, they add new extension
> for their x509 certificates called CA Version. I try to add that new oid
> into the config file but it seems my cert doesn't contains the extension
> after creating it..
> 

If you added the OID and info to the relevant section you'd probably get
an error. Extensions need additional support to encode, decode, print
and set them. 

So without that lot it wont work. Is that particular extension
documented anywhere?

> One other thing, I also try to add CRL Distribution extension into the
> cert? Can it just being added into the config file? Can somebody show me
> some example on how to do that?
> 

docs/openssl.txt gives info about supported extensions and their syntax.
